That's a photo of Hiroo Onoda, a WWII Japanese solider who continued to "fight" for 30 years on the island of Lubang. Presumably the photo is intended to compare to OP to Onoda's dogged refusal to stand down. 🤷‍♀️ More about Onoda here: en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hiroo_O...

Researchers have registered more than 120 clinical trials to date evaluating the potential of mRNA-based approaches for treating many types of cancer, including lung, breast, and prostate, pancreatic, and brain tumors.

Table 1. Clinical trials of mRNA cancer therapeutics initiated in the years from 2019 to August 2024

While I agree student surveys are primarily useful for identifying exceptionally bad teachers, they can be crafted so that some useful information can be gleaned. For example, MPOW’s surveys ask if the faculty made explicit connections between the course content & future career skills or knowledge.
